Nobori Japanese banners, carps, warrior’s Yoroi and Kabuto (helmet), Musha-ningyo dolls and samurai swords are all the part of the display used for the Boy’s Days (renamed to Children’s Day), May 5th, in Japan. Culturally, the Japanese emphasize anything to do with children. The Girl’s day with hina dolls is in March. This Day is to wish for their son's health and future welfare. It is also to inspire boys in their manliness and hopefully bravery, discipline and honor codes come with it...

This is a Russian enamel "Cup of Sorrow" dated 1896 having the Imperial crest of the double headed eagle commemorating the Coronation of Czar Nicholas II and Empress Alexandra Fedorovna and ultimately resulting in his overthrow. This cup is in overall good condition but does have some rust spots along the rim and base. It is approximately 4 1/8 in. H
